About The Position

Deepgram is looking for an Event & Office Experience Manager to bring energy, organization, and creativity to our San Francisco office. This role blends major event production with day-to-day office management — you’ll plan and execute everything from executive summits and customer meetings to community networking events that showcase our brand and culture. You’ll be the face of our SF office: curating an environment where employees, guests, and customers feel welcomed and inspired. This is an ideal role for someone who thrives on juggling details, thinking three steps ahead, and creating memorable experiences that make people say, “We have to do that again.”

Requirements

  • 4+ years of experience in event planning, office management, or hospitality.
  • Proven success running high-impact corporate events end-to-end.
  • Excellent project management, organization, and vendor negotiation skills.
  • Warm, polished communicator who can host senior executives and customers with ease.
  • Creative eye for design and experience-driven environments.
  • Comfortable managing multiple projects and shifting pri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• SF-based and able to be onsite full-time to lead events and manage the office.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ience in tech, startups, or high-growth environments.
  • Passion for connecting people and curating experiences that build community.

Responsibilities

  • Plan, produce, and execute events including executive offsites, customer meetings, networking receptions, and internal gatherings.
  • Own logistics end-to-end: venues, catering, AV, travel coordination, signage, and on-site support.
  • Partner closely with leadership, Marketing, and Customer Success to ensure events reinforce company goals and brand presence.
  • Manage vendor relationships and budgets; negotiate contracts and track spend.
  • Oversee day-to-day office operations — supplies, facilities, visitors, and ensuring the space runs smoothly and reflects our culture.
  • Be the point of contact for visiting executives, partners, and customers; ensure meetings run seamlessly.
  • Support special projects, such as offsites or board meetings, that bring teams together in meaningful ways.
  • Maintain and purchase company swag for events
